The Kromski Weaver’s Choice variable dent heddle makes it possible for the weaver to decide exactly what size heddle to use on a thread by thread basis.
We are no longer confined to using a single sized thread for the warp. Nor are we confined to one size on a given section. Each heddle is an individual piece, thus allowing the weaver to use an endless combination of thread sizes.

Available in 5, 8, 10, and 12 dpi. DPI, or “dents per inch,” indicates the number of warp threads that can be placed per inch across the width of your project.
